The Chemical Properties of Manganese Dioxide in Industrial Use
Manganese dioxide (MnO2) is a compound that commands significant attention across various industrial sectors due to its unique chemical properties. While it is widely recognized as a colorant for glass and ceramics, its capabilities as a catalyst and oxidant are equally critical for chemical synthesis and electrochemical applications. Understanding these properties is key for any industrial buyer or formulator seeking to leverage this versatile inorganic material.
As a pigment, MnO2's interaction within molten glass or ceramic glazes allows it to impart a spectrum of colors. The specific shade achieved, whether it's a deep purple, a vibrant blue, or an intense black, is dependent on the concentration of MnO2, the base glass or glaze composition, and the firing conditions. Beyond its aesthetic contributions, manganese dioxide functions effectively as a catalyst. Its catalytic activity is often utilized in oxidation reactions, such as the decomposition of hydrogen peroxide or the oxidation of organic compounds. As an oxidant, MnO2 readily accepts electrons, making it a powerful oxidizing agent. This property is fundamental to its use in primary batteries, where it acts as the cathode material, facilitating the electrochemical reaction that generates electricity.
